Cadillac has played a significant role in Jim Beam's history. Every evening, Jim Beam, our brand’s legendary founder, would place a mason jar of his proprietary yeast – the living heart of his protected recipe – in the front seat of his Cadillac and drive it home to protect it from fire and prohibition, preserving the recipe that defines Jim Beam’s unmatched flavor today. Zsoka Taylor McDonald reposted thisZsoka Taylor McDonald reposted thisYamazaki - one of the most admired Japanese whiskies in the world - has introduced its oldest 100% Mizunara-cask-aged expression from the House of Suntory. Mizunara is a type of oak that's native to Japan and notoriously difficult to use. Our chief blender Shinji Fukuyo told Food & Wine that when whisky is aged in these casks for 10 years, the characteristic “spicy aroma of Mizunara can be sensed in the finish..at 25 years and beyond that Mizunara truly reveals its potential." Zsoka Taylor McDonald liked thisZsoka Taylor McDonald liked thisToday was a powerful reminder of what sustainability looks like in action. We were back in the Central Appalachian Mountains at Ataya Forest with our partners Green Forests Work and The Nature Conservancy —marking our fifth year restoring a former coal mine. What was once degraded land is steadily becoming a thriving forest again. To date, we’ve help plant more than 1 million trees, including 75,000 in this corridor—helping restore habitat in one of the most biologically rich temperate forests in the world and reconnect a critical pathway for migratory species. For us at Suntory Global Spirits, this work is also tied to our craft. White oak, essential for our barrels, depends on healthy, resilient forests—making restoration efforts like this vital for the future. This work reflects what we believe at Suntory: that we grow our business in harmony with nature, not separate from it.

Zsoka Taylor McDonald liked thisZsoka Taylor McDonald liked thisOn March 18, I had the privilege to attend Suntory’s Yatte Minahare Awards at Suntory Hall in Tokyo, Japan. “Yatte Minahare” is one of Suntory Group’s three corporate values – translated from Japanese, it means having the conviction to challenge convention and willingly pursue bold goals with tenacity. I joined the 10 finalist teams from across the Suntory Group as they presented their inspiring Yatte Minahare projects at the awards ceremony and then spent around two weeks traveling Japan being out in the “gemba” (translates to “the real place,” aka, being away from your desk to observe and connect in the real world).
